Rhabdomyosarcoma of the Nasal Vestibule in a Child
Abstract
A case of rhabdomyosarcoma in a 2 year old girl without a pre-existing predisposing factor visited the ENT Department of Sultan Qaboos University Hospital (SQUH). Her clinical condition did not point to the diagnosis, which came as a histological surprise. The histopathology report was alveolar rhabdomyosarcoma.
